Population and Economic Growth Loop : As employment opportunities increase in a city, people are attracted into the urban area. However, in-migrants do not immediately swarm to employment opportunities in the area. Since migrants react to perceived opportunity, the lag in acquiring information may cause 5 to 20 year delay in response. Population growth from the influx of migrants tends to encourage business expansion in the growing urban area. The additional economical expansion creates demand for additional labor. This demand further increases employment opportunities in the area. Population and Land Use Loop : While tending to reinforce economic growth, population growth tends to drive housing construction at a greater pace to match population growth. Assuming only a fixed amount of land available for industrial and housing use, increasing the housing stock makes less land available for business expansion. As the unavailability of more land begins to suppress business expansion in the area, the demand for labour decreased. Consequently, local employment opportunities decline. Once potential migrants perceive the lack of opportunities, declining in-migration generates a reduction in the population growth of the area.
